This Tuesday, February 10,  the TV magazine EXTRA! will feature a segment on
breastfeeding. I was actively involved in assisting them with filming in the
NYC area (finding mothers, breastfeeding friendly work sites, a local LLL
Leader - that kind of thing), where the focus was to have been breastfeeding
in the work place.  However, at the last minute, the assignment was given to a
California producer and from what I understand, it has taken a more
breastfeeding in public theme.

From all reports, it sounds like a positive piece. The gal I was working with
here did explain that "of course we have to show both sides of the issue" but
that their "other side" was "a guy who is just not believable".

EXTRA! is a syndicated show and so is on different TV stations throughout the
country (and I'm not sure if syndicated in other parts of the world).  Please
check your TV listings for time and channel.
